Athens-Limestone Public Library Foundation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 254,721 | 273,857 | −19,136 | 0.0 | 0% |
| 2012 | 1,094,160 | 1,159,050 | −64,890 | 1.8 | 0% |
| 2013 | 1,645,336 | 1,516,407 | 128,929 | 2.4 | 0% |
| 2014 | 271,778 | 1,434,890 | −1,163,112 | -7.2 | 0% |
| 2015 | 134,508 | 142,149 | −7,641 | -73.4 | 0% |
| 2016 | 147,634 | 101,491 | 46,143 | -97.3 | 0% |
| 2017 | 225,808 | 127,514 | 98,294 | -68.2 | 0% |
| 2018 | 569,824 | 187,906 | 381,918 | -21.9 | 0% |
| 2019 | 144,583 | 166,487 | −21,904 | -26.3 | 0% |
| 2020 | 71,648 | 152,162 | −80,514 | -39.9 | 20% |
| 2021 | 116,255 | 219,117 | −102,862 | -34.9 | — |
| 2022 | 116,101 | 124,570 | −8,469 | -62.2 | — |
| 2023 | 549,869 | 76,167 | 473,702 | -27.5 | 14%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$473,702 more than it spent. Its liabilities exceeded its net assets — reserves were below zero (-27.5 months), down from 0 in 2011. Staff pay was 14%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
